Transaction 01e61f425a2276175643840fcf6853a3e5d1be007f3dbdd5d5e885f88c7af001
1 Input
2 Outputs
- 01e61f425a2276175643840fcf6853a3e5d1be007f3dbdd5d5e885f88c7af001:0
- 01e61f425a2276175643840fcf6853a3e5d1be007f3dbdd5d5e885f88c7af001:1
value 2865967
address 32Cj8X2FvNVt8RmhDZzmCgjxaEQrHwvRYY
value 2886687
address 17LED8ucsVTjhV7mhH69LqxWbMauFpxs3j